[发明专利]手写笔笔迹偏移补偿方法、手写笔、存储介质及装置有效
申请号: | 201910307992.5 | 申请日: | 2019-04-16 |
公开(公告)号: | CN110069148B | 公开(公告)日: | 2022-03-15 |
发明(设计)人: | 张春辉 | 申请(专利权)人: | 深圳腾千里科技有限公司 |
主分类号: | G06F3/0354 | 分类号: | G06F3/0354 |
代理公司: | 深圳市世纪恒程知识产权代理事务所 44287 | 代理人: | 胡海国 |
地址: | 518000 广东省深圳市宝安区西*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 手写 笔笔 偏移 补偿 方法 存储 介质 装置 | ||
1.一种手写笔笔迹偏移补偿方法,其特征在于,所述手写笔笔迹偏移补偿方法包括以下步骤:
通过摄像头采集第一起始码点的第一坐标信息和当前码点的第二坐标信息,所述第一起始码点和所述当前码点为书写页面上的码点,其中,所述码点包含该码点位置的坐标信息;
根据所述第一坐标信息和所述第二坐标信息计算所述第一起始码点和所述当前码点之间的预测距离;
判断所述预测距离是否小于预设误差距离;
若所述预测距离小于所述预设误差距离,则获取所述第一起始码点至所述当前码点之间的第一中间码点,并获取所述第一起始码点至所述当前码点的书写方向,其中,所述第一中间码点为所述第一起始码点至所述当前码点之间采集到的若干码点中的码点,所述书写方向由所述第一起始码点、所述第一中间码点和所述当前码点的出现顺序确定;
获取所述第一起始码点在所述书写方向上的邻居码点,并将所述第一中间码点和所述当前码点移动至所述第一起始码点的邻居码点处,其中,所述邻居码点是在所述书写方向上与所述第一起始码点相距一个码点距离的码点。
2.如权利要求1所述的手写笔笔迹偏移补偿方法,其特征在于,所述将所述第一中间码点和所述当前码点移动至所述第一起始码点的邻居码点处之后,所述手写笔笔迹偏移补偿方法还包括:
将移动后的当前码点作为新的第一起始码点,并返回所述通过摄像头采集第一起始码点的第一坐标信息和当前码点的第二坐标信息的步骤。
3.如权利要求1-2中任一项所述的手写笔笔迹偏移补偿方法,其特征在于,所述判断所述预测距离是否小于预设误差距离之前,所述手写笔笔迹偏移补偿方法还包括:
获取所述摄像头与笔尖之间的水平距离,并将所述水平距离的两倍作为预设误差距离。
4.如权利要求3所述的手写笔笔迹偏移补偿方法,其特征在于,所述判断所述预测距离是否小于预设误差距离之后,所述手写笔笔迹偏移补偿方法还包括:
若所述预测距离不小于所述预设误差距离,则显示所述第一起始码点至所述当前码点之间的当前曲线,并获取所述当前曲线上以所述水平距离为半径的圆弧;
获取所述圆弧的第二起始码点、第二中间码点和终止码点,将所述第二中间码点和第二终止码点移动至所述第二起始码点的邻居码点处。
5.如权利要求1-2中任一项所述的手写笔笔迹偏移补偿方法,其特征在于,所述通过摄像头采集第一起始码点的第一坐标信息和当前码点的第二坐标信息,具体包括:
通过摄像头拍摄第一起始码点的第一码点图像和当前码点的第二码点图像;
从所述第一码点图像中识别出所述第一起始码点的第一坐标信息,并从所述第二码点图像中识别出所述当前码点的第二坐标信息。
6.如权利要求5所述的手写笔笔迹偏移补偿方法,其特征在于,所述通过摄像头采集起始码点的第一坐标信息和当前码点的第二坐标信息之前,所述手写笔笔迹偏移补偿方法还包括:
当通过压力传感器检测到压力时,判断所述压力是否大于预设压力阈值;
若所述压力大于所述预设压力阈值,则触发摄像头进行拍摄。
7.一种手写笔,其特征在于,所述手写笔包括:存储器、处理器及存储在所述存储器上并可在所述处理器上运行的手写笔笔迹偏移补偿程序,所述手写笔笔迹偏移补偿程序被所述处理器执行时实现如权利要求1至6中任一项所述的手写笔笔迹偏移补偿方法的步骤。
8.一种存储介质,其特征在于,所述存储介质上存储有手写笔笔迹偏移补偿程序,所述手写笔笔迹偏移补偿程序被处理器执行时实现如权利要求1至6中任一项所述的手写笔笔迹偏移补偿方法的步骤。
9.一种手写笔笔迹偏移补偿装置,其特征在于,所述手写笔笔迹偏移补偿装置包括:
信息获取模块,用于通过摄像头采集第一起始码点的第一坐标信息和当前码点的第二坐标信息,所述第一起始码点和所述当前码点为书写页面上的码点,其中,所述码点包含该码点位置的坐标信息;
距离计算模块,用于根据所述第一坐标信息和所述第二坐标信息计算所述第一起始码点和所述当前码点之间的预测距离;
误差判断模块,用于判断所述预测距离是否小于预设误差距离;
误差校正模块,用于若所述预测距离小于所述预设误差距离,则获取所述第一起始码点至所述当前码点之间的第一中间码点,并获取所述第一起始码点至所述当前码点的书写方向,其中,所述第一中间码点为所述第一起始码点至所述当前码点之间采集到的若干码点中的码点,所述书写方向由所述第一起始码点、所述第一中间码点和所述当前码点的出现顺序确定;获取所述第一起始码点在所述书写方向上的邻居码点,并将所述第一中间码点和所述当前码点移动至所述第一起始码点的邻居码点处,其中,所述邻居码点是在所述书写方向上与所述第一起始码点相距一个码点距离的码点。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于深圳腾千里科技有限公司,未经深圳腾千里科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910307992.5/1.html,转载请声明来源钻瓜专利网。
- 上一篇:操控装置及其控制方法
- 下一篇:一种自发电蓝牙鼠标